About Tahiti
Tahiti is famously divided into two circular land masses connected by a narrow isthmus: the larger, wilder Tahiti Nui (Big Tahiti) and the smaller, quieter Tahiti Iti (Little Tahiti). Its history is epic, from early Polynesian settlement around 200-300 AD to the pivotal arrivals of European explorers like Samuel Wallis, Louis-Antoine de Bougainville, and Captain James Cook. The island is most famous as the site of Point Venus, where Cook observed the transit of Venus in 1769, and Matavai Bay, which served as a key anchorage. Today, Tahiti is the political, economic, and cultural heart of French Polynesia. Papeete, the capital on the northwest coast, is a lively port city known for its vibrant market, municipal market, and waterfront scene. The island's culture is a proud fusion of Ma'ohi (indigenous Polynesian) heritage and French sophistication, evident in the language, cuisine, and lifestyle. While famous for its stunning lagoon and surf breaks like Teahupo'o, Tahiti's interior reveals deep valleys, towering waterfalls, and sacred archaeological sites called *marae*, offering a stark contrast to the coastal paradise.
Best Time to Visit Tahiti
The best time to visit Tahiti is during the drier, slightly cooler season from May to October. This period offers plenty of sunshine, lower humidity, and minimal rainfall, making it ideal for outdoor activities, lagoon excursions, and hiking. It is also the peak tourist season, so expect higher prices and more crowds, especially in July and August. The wetter, hotter season runs from November to April, bringing higher humidity, more frequent (though often brief) tropical showers, and a lusher landscape. This is the off-peak season, with better deals on accommodation, but it also coincides with the risk of cyclones, particularly between January and March. Major cultural events are spread throughout the year. July is highlighted by the Heiva i Tahiti festival, a spectacular month-long celebration of Polynesian dance, music, and sports. The Hawaiki Nui Va'a outrigger canoe race in late October/early November is another major event. The Tahiti International Golf Open is in September. December and January are festive with Christmas and New Year celebrations.
